Richard Fred Johnson

Richard Johnson is a partner with Hughes Socol Piers Resnick & Dym, Ltd. He concentrates his practice in the areas of insurance law, transportation law, and personal injury. Mr. Johnson has over 30 years of experience in nearly all types of civil litigation, including construction, railroad, admiralty, commercial, and insurance.

Mr. Johnson has extensive experience in claims involving the hospitality industry. This includes hotels, restaurants, theaters, and bars. Mr. Johnson also has extensive experience in claims against municipalities and other local governmental entities and insurers, including zoning disputes, civil rights claims, tax issues, and wrongful termination claims. In addition, he is experienced in the defense of arson claims.

Mr. Johnson practices law in state and federal court, where he has successfully tried numerous cases to verdict.
